Position Overview – Associate Attorney (Wenatchee Office)GLP Attorneys is seeking an Associate Attorney to join our Wenatchee office in a case‑managing role. This position offers the opportunity to handle a diverse caseload while working closely with a dedicated support team. The role combines litigation, negotiation, andન case management responsibilities, with a strong focus on client advocacy and achieving meaningful outcomes.
As a case‑managing Associate Attorney, you will oversee matters from client intake through resolution, including litigation and trial work. You will lead and mentor a team—typically consisting of a paralegal and a legal assistant—while collaborating with colleagues across the firm to deliver exceptional service.
We are looking for an attorney who is not only committed to excellence in legal practice but also to building strong client relationships and maintaining a client‑centered approach in every aspect of representation. In addition, this role includes opportunities to engage in community outreach and development, helping extend the firm’s mission of service beyond the courtroom.
This position is ideal for an attorney who is passionate about personal injury law, values professional growth, and thrives in a supportive, team‑oriented environment where both career success and community impact are encouraged.

RequirementsQualified candidates will bring the following experience and skills:
- Managing cases from client intake through claim resolution
- Litigation and trial experience, including strong oral and written advocacy skills
- Case management, negotiation, and settlement experience with proven results
- Minimum of one to three years of relevant legal experience
- Active member of the Washington State Bar in good standing
- Prior personal injury law experience strongly preferred
- Strong supervisory and leadership skills, with the ability to mentor and guide a team typically consisting of a paralegal and a legal assistant
- Demonstrated ability to build and maintain strong client relationships, with a client‑centered and compassionate approach
- Excellent organizational skills and the ability to manage a high‑volume caseload effectively
- Commitment to community engagement and professional development, aligning with the firm’s mission and values
- High ethical standards, integrity, and the ability to thrive in a collaborative, team‑oriented environment
Compensation and Benefits:
- Base salary range: $85,000 – $95,000 (exempt, case‑managing꽃 Associate Attorney)
- Bonus eligibility:
Case managing Associate Attorneys are bonus‑eligible and often earn 100% or more of their base in bonuses in a calendar year. Bonuses are awarded based on performance and vary by Attorney.
